    Essential Concepts and Materials

    To make a cylinder out of paper, you'll need a few basic materials:

    • Paper: The type of paper you choose will depend on the desired strength and appearance of your cylinder. Standard printer paper is suitable for basic projects, while thicker cardstock or construction paper will provide more durability. Specialty papers, such as decorative or textured paper, can add visual interest to your creations.
    • Scissors or a Paper Cutter: For precise cuts and clean edges, a good pair of scissors or a paper cutter is essential. A rotary cutter can also be useful for cutting large sheets of paper quickly and accurately.
    • Adhesive: The adhesive you use will depend on the type of paper and the desired strength of the bond. Options include:
      • Glue Stick: Ideal for lightweight paper and general crafts.
      • White Glue (e.g., Elmer's): Provides a stronger bond than glue sticks and is suitable for thicker paper.
      • Double-Sided Tape: Offers a clean and instant bond, perfect for projects where appearance is important.
      • Hot Glue: Provides a very strong and fast bond but requires caution due to the heat.
    • Ruler or Measuring Tape: Accurate measurements are crucial for creating cylinders of specific dimensions.
    • Pencil: For marking measurements and guidelines on the paper.
    • Optional Tools:
      • Cutting Mat: Protects your work surface when using scissors or a rotary cutter.
      • Bone Folder: Helps create crisp, clean folds.
      • Clips or Clamps: Useful for holding the cylinder together while the adhesive dries.

    Techniques for Different Sizes and Strengths

    The technique you use to make a paper cylinder can vary depending on the size and strength you need. For small cylinders, you can simply roll the paper tightly and secure the edge with glue or tape. For larger cylinders, you may need to use a thicker paper or reinforce the seam with additional adhesive or tape.

    To create a very strong cylinder, consider using multiple layers of paper. You can wrap a thinner paper around a core made of thicker cardstock, or create a laminated effect by gluing multiple layers of paper together. Another technique is to use corrugated cardboard for added strength, although this will result in a less smooth surface.

    Methods for Ensuring a Clean and Professional Finish

    Achieving a clean and professional finish requires attention to detail and careful execution. Start by ensuring that your paper is free of wrinkles and creases. Use a sharp blade or scissors to make precise cuts, and avoid tearing the paper. When applying adhesive, use a small amount and spread it evenly to prevent lumps or bubbles.

    To create a seamless join, overlap the edges of the paper slightly and align them carefully before applying adhesive. Use clips or clamps to hold the cylinder together while the glue dries, ensuring that the seam remains straight and even. Once the adhesive is dry, you can trim any excess paper or smooth out any imperfections with a bone folder.

    Tips and Expert Advice

    Creating perfect paper cylinders requires a combination of skill, patience, and attention to detail. Here are some tips and expert advice to help you achieve professional-looking results:

    1. Choose the Right Paper: The type of paper you use will have a significant impact on the strength and appearance of your cylinder. For general crafts, standard printer paper or construction paper is fine. However, for projects that require more durability, consider using cardstock or specialty paper. Experiment with different weights and textures to find the perfect paper for your needs.

      Consider the grain of the paper as well. Rolling with the grain will result in a smoother, more even cylinder. To determine the grain, gently bend the paper in both directions. The direction that offers less resistance is the direction of the grain.

    2. Measure Accurately: Accurate measurements are essential for creating cylinders of specific dimensions. Use a ruler or measuring tape to measure the length and width of the paper, and mark the measurements clearly with a pencil. Double-check your measurements before cutting to avoid errors.

      When measuring, consider the overlap needed for the seam. Add an extra half-inch to the length of the paper to allow for a secure and seamless join. This extra material will ensure that the edges of the paper meet properly and create a strong bond.

    3. Cut Precisely: Precise cuts are crucial for creating clean and even edges. Use a sharp pair of scissors or a paper cutter to cut the paper, and follow the marked lines carefully. Avoid tearing the paper, as this can create jagged edges that are difficult to align.

      For long, straight cuts, a paper cutter is the best option. A rotary cutter can also be useful for cutting large sheets of paper quickly and accurately. If using scissors, try cutting along a ruler or straight edge to ensure a clean and straight cut.

    4. Apply Adhesive Evenly: The key to a strong and seamless join is to apply the adhesive evenly. Use a small amount of adhesive and spread it thinly over the entire surface of the paper. Avoid using too much adhesive, as this can cause lumps or bubbles that will detract from the appearance of the cylinder.

      Different adhesives have different properties, so choose the right adhesive for your project. Glue sticks are ideal for lightweight paper, while white glue provides a stronger bond for thicker paper. Double-sided tape offers a clean and instant bond, perfect for projects where appearance is important.

    5. Secure the Seam: Once you have applied the adhesive, carefully align the edges of the paper and press them together firmly. Use clips or clamps to hold the cylinder together while the glue dries. This will ensure that the seam remains straight and even, and that the adhesive bonds properly.

      Allow the adhesive to dry completely before removing the clips or clamps. This may take several hours, depending on the type of adhesive you are using. Be patient and avoid rushing the process, as this can weaken the bond and compromise the strength of the cylinder.

    6. Reinforce the Cylinder: For projects that require extra strength, consider reinforcing the cylinder with additional layers of paper or tape. You can wrap a thinner paper around a core made of thicker cardstock, or create a laminated effect by gluing multiple layers of paper together.

      Another option is to use clear packing tape to reinforce the seam. Apply the tape along the inside and outside of the seam to create a strong and durable bond. This technique is particularly useful for cylinders that will be subjected to stress or weight.

    7. Smooth Out Imperfections: Once the adhesive is dry, inspect the cylinder for any imperfections. Use a bone folder or a smooth, hard object to smooth out any bumps or wrinkles in the paper. Trim any excess paper with scissors or a craft knife.

      If you notice any gaps or inconsistencies in the seam, apply a small amount of adhesive and press the edges together firmly. Use a damp cloth to wipe away any excess adhesive and allow it to dry completely.

    FAQ

    Q: What is the best type of paper to use for making a strong cylinder? A: Cardstock or thicker construction paper provides more durability than standard printer paper. For maximum strength, consider using multiple layers of paper or reinforcing the cylinder with tape.

    Q: How do I prevent my paper cylinder from collapsing? A: Use a thicker paper, reinforce the seam with extra adhesive or tape, and consider adding internal supports, such as cardboard rings or struts.

    Q: What is the best adhesive for creating a seamless join? A: Double-sided tape or white glue works well for creating a seamless join. Apply the adhesive evenly and use clips or clamps to hold the cylinder together while it dries.

    Q: How do I make a cylinder with a specific diameter? A: Calculate the circumference of the desired cylinder (Circumference = π * Diameter). Cut a piece of paper to this length, plus an extra half-inch for the seam, and roll it into a cylinder.

    Q: Can I use recycled paper to make cylinders? A: Yes, recycled paper works well for many projects. Just be aware that it may not be as strong as virgin paper, so you may need to reinforce the cylinder.
